POSITION SUMMARY

The Special Assistant will report directly to and offer high-level administrative and project management support to the CDO, and occasional support to the Vice President of Development. The ideal individual will have the ability to exercise good judgment in a diversity of situations, with strong written and verbal communication, administrative, and organizational skills, and the ability to maintain a realistic balance among multiple priorities.  Strong candidates will ensure that the right people are in the right place at the right time doing the right things on the proper schedule. They ensure that workflows involving the CDO come together in an efficient and timely way.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Introduce and maintain project management tools as needed to keep CDO’s key priorities clear, organized and on track.
  • Manage the status, resources and timelines for key projects and specific work flows, ensuring internal constituencies are aligned and informed.
  • Build, oversee and drive the CDO’s calendar, including ensuring sufficient preparation for and follow-up from meetings.
  • Coordinate with Ocean Conservancy staff to ensure preparation, production, and distribution of background and briefing materials, binders, and itineraries related to meetings, presentations, conferences, and travel. Assist with meeting production and logistics as needed.
  • A key liaison between the CDO and other departments, ensuring excellent communication, transparency, alignment and partnership across the organization’s teams. Ability to work and coordinate with the special assistants of other senior leaders at OC.
  • Facilitate timely and efficient information flow from Development Directors to the CDO, including compilation of meeting agendas, management of deadlines, scheduling of meeting debriefs and circulation of notes for critical meetings.
